Use the water level indicator WITH
COFFEE BASKET when ground coffee has
been added to coffee filter basket and is
positioned in the water tank. Use the water
level indicator WITHOUT COFFEE BASKET
when coffee filter basket is not positioned
in the water tank.
NOTE: The water tank may be removed to
fill. Use the handle to remove water tank
from the unit. Slowly pour the desired
amount of cold water into water tank
and place securely back into the unit.
Replace coffeemaker lid. NEVER POUR
WATER DIRECTLY INTO THE BODY OF
THE UNIT WITHOUT THE WATER TANK
SECURELY IN PLACE.
3. Position carafe and plug in unit
Insert carafe lid and filter into the carafe
and place carafe on the resting plate. Plug
coffeemaker into an electrical outlet. If the
coffeemaker remains untouched for 30
minutes, it will enter standby mode and all
lights will be off. Press any button to wake
up the unit.
4. Set strength preference
The default strength setting is Medium.
Press Mild or Bold button to change
selection. The LED on the selected
strength button will illuminate.
NOTE: The brew time varies according to
the strength selected. See times below:
5. Start brewing
Press the Brew button to begin the brew
cycle. The Brew LED will illuminate and
brewing will begin. The coffee filter basket
gently spins and pauses throughout the
brew cycle.
To cancel brewing, press Brew button
once; the indicator light will go off and
brew cycle will stop.
6. After brewing
When the brewing cycle has been
completed, 3 beeps will sound and the
Brew and selected strength LEDs will start
flashing, signaling that the coffee is ready
to be released into the carafe.
7. Release coffee into the carafe
Slide the coffee release lever to the
right, to the Release position. Blue coffee
release indicator light will illuminate and
white indicator lights will go off. Coffee will
stream into the carafe for approximately 2
minutes. The coffee filter basket will go
through a final spin cycle while coffee is
being filtered into the carafe. Once the
coffee release cycle is finished, 5 beeps
will sound, indicating that coffee is ready
to be served.
